I'm in the same boat, been eyeing the drag, charon and either the ipv vesta or eclipse. Currently using a smok alien and so far so good. No real issues, a tiny bit of paint chips here and there despite using a silicone sleeve since day one. The temp control was really disappointing, I figured it would be at least decent. My istick tc100w the temp control was ok, it worked for the most part and it was less expensive than the alien.

Not really fond of the high battery cutoff on the smoant's. Some people have commented on the charon's 510 being loose and the only way to tighten it is to remove one of the wires inside first to get to the nut.

The ipv's caught my eye because of their size/shape being similar to the alien which I really like. I've seen some reviewers with issues on the 510 not being deep enough and leaving a gap between the mod and atomizer. It can be screwed down a bit I think but not sure if it screws the wire inside also. Would hate to bust it off trying to get an atomizer to fit flush.

Not sure if I'd like the battlestar or not, haven't used anything shaped like it. Looks a bit wide where the 2 batteries fit. Not sure how much tc accuracy difference there is between the yihi, gene chip and smoant's chip.

I don't have the Drag, but I do have the Charon and have been very pleased with it. I've been using it quite a bit over the last couple months and have had zero issues. I've been using it primarily in TC mode and it works better than most other mods at it's price point. Fires quick in Power mode too, so no complaints.

Just a quick note on the drag. The TVF 8 and other atomizers with long pins sometimes display short. To fix it take the top of the battery wrap and just put it on your 510. Problem solved. Only some atomizers do this but just take the top bit off the battery and then never worry about it again.
